**JOB SUMMARY**

Responsible to the Executive Director and supervised by the Willow Place Clinical Supervisor, the Family Violence Counselor is responsible for planning, implementing and evaluating programs designed to provide holistic services for individuals experiencing or using family violence/abuse. The family violence counselor provides individual and group counseling to residential and non-residential clients. The counselor maintains a current and broad network of community-based and public sector services and stays current with best and emerging practices in the field. The counselor provides immediate crisis stabilization services as well as longer term support to assist clients achieve stable housing, economic stability, positive community connections and healthy relationships.

**MAIN D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ES**

**COUNSELLING**:

- Completes a structured comprehensive written intake and assessment for each women requesting services.
- Ensures each residential client receives one hour counseling each day they are in shelter. Meets with a minimum of 3-4 clients per shift.
- Empowers women to make informed choices by providing information, resources and opportunities to understand family and gender-based violence and by supporting them in developing and implementing a client-centered plan. Provides a progressive goal-oriented, holistic and multi-modality process for accomplishing this. Reinforces or expands the problem-solving capacity of the client.
- Ensures each residential client (and clients calling the crisis line whenever possible) has an up to date protection plan. The protection plan should include but not be limited to internet safety.
- Facilitates group counseling for residential and outreach clients which may include staff, students and volunteers as co-facilitators.
- Provides information and counseling support to crisis line callers.
- Completes a departure interview with each client.

**ADVOCACY**:

- Provides information regarding community supports and opportunities. Where necessary acts as a liaison, advocate, referral agent and in some cases the case manager with outside agencies to provide coordination of services for clients.
- Provides education and information on abuse to outside agencies to improve services to women and children as required
- Maintains a broad and current network of community agencies and services and represents Willow Place in a professional manner.

**CLIENT RELATIONS**:

- Proactively creates a space of unconditional positive regard that allows clients a safe space to focus on their own mental, emotional, physical and spiritual well-being.
- Models healthy relationship behaviors in all interactions in the work environment.
- Competently, respectfully and appropriately deals with aggressive or inappropriate behaviors without personalizing the behavior.

**PROGRAMMING**:

- Develops and maintains the content, process and materials for facilitating a minimum of two groups monthly.
